Ingredient concerns
- Pea Protein (medium concern): Plant-based protein concentrates like pea protein can artificially inflate the total protein percentage on guaranteed analysis without providing the same amino acid profile as animal proteins. Associated with the FDA investigation into grain-free diets and dilated cardiomyopathy (DCM) in dogs, though a causal link has not been definitively established.
- Sodium Selenite (low concern): Sodium selenite is an inorganic form of selenium with a narrower safety margin than organic forms (such as selenium yeast). It has lower bioavailability and higher potential for toxicity at elevated levels compared to organic selenium sources. Some premium pet foods use selenium yeast instead as a safer alternative.
Guaranteed analysis (dry-matter basis)
On a dry-matter basis (water removed for a fair wet-vs-dry comparison): protein 36.7%, fat 18.9%, fiber 4.4%, ash 7.8%, carbohydrate 32.2%. By calories: 32% from protein, 40% from fat, 28% from carbohydrate.
AAFCO compliance
This food meets the AAFCO adult cat nutrient minimums we can verify — protein 36.7% vs 26% minimum, fat 18.9% vs 9% minimum.
Dry food, with grains, for the adult life stage.
